Cancelling a Appeal

Rate this question


Wjason777

Question

Hello

I filled and appeal back in 2011 for back, tmj, sinuses/ allergies. Etc

To make a long story short, back in 2012 they cancelled it due to failure to respond with a form 9. Which was a lie and I have proof. Didn't find out that it was closed until 2014. 

I ended up going to my local congressman and submitting all the proof that I had indeed responded on time. 

In 2015 my appeal was reopened and I received a apology from the regional appeals coach. 

With 6th year of waiting  approaching, with still no response or progress . I think it's best that I just cancel the appeal and resubmit as a regular claim. 

My questions to you guys is ,

Is that even possible to cancel and appeal?

Would it be the right thing to do at this point?

Should I go back to my local congressman to get it cancelled?

Would I still be able to use all the evidence that i submitted for the appeal?
